What is DAM?
DAM, short for Digital Asset Management, is a software system that allows organizations to store, organize, and distribute their digital assets efficiently. Digital assets can include images, videos, audio files, documents, and other media types. By utilizing DAM, businesses can streamline their content management processes, ensuring that the right content is delivered to the right audience at the right time.
Definition and Explanation of DAM
Digital Asset Management is a comprehensive solution that provides a centralized repository for digital assets. It allows businesses to categorize and organize their assets, making them easily searchable and accessible. By implementing DAM, organizations can automate workflows, enforce version control, and collaborate seamlessly, ultimately improving the content delivery process.

Key Features and Functionality of DAM
In order to fully harness the power of DAM in web content delivery, it is essential to understand its key features and functionality.
Digital Asset Storage and Organization
DAM provides a secure and scalable storage solution for digital assets. Assets are organized into folders or categories, making them easy to locate and retrieve. With advanced search capabilities, content creators can find assets based on specific criteria, saving time and effort.
Metadata Management
Metadata is crucial in ensuring the accessibility and searchability of assets. DAM allows businesses to assign metadata to assets, including keywords, descriptions, and copyright information. This metadata enables efficient asset management and facilitates accurate asset attribution.
Version Control and Collaboration
Version control is vital in maintaining the integrity of digital assets. DAM enables businesses to track and manage different versions of assets, ensuring that only the most recent and approved versions are used in web content delivery. Furthermore, DAM facilitates collaboration by providing a platform for content creators, designers, and other stakeholders to work together seamlessly, ensuring a smooth content delivery process.
Integration with Content Management Systems
Integration with content management systems is a key feature of DAM. By seamlessly integrating with existing CMS platforms, DAM allows businesses to publish assets directly from the DAM system, eliminating the need for manual uploads. This integration streamlines the content delivery process, ensuring efficient and timely updates to web content.
